Ticket PV-2241: Expired service credentials for WikiGate RBAC sync

The nightly job that syncs role-based access groups into our Pellwood wiki failed at 02:10 — the WikiGate service credential expired after the standard 90-day window. Role changes made yesterday have not propagated, so verify permissions manually until the sync reruns. A replacement key has been issued and appears below.

app token of tadug-yahag = vxb3-949

## Deploying the Gatewick Proctor Queue

Deploys are pretty painless: push to main, wait for the pipeline, then watch the queue drain dashboard for five minutes. If candidates pile up mid-exam, roll back first and ask questions later — the queue replays safely. Everything the workers care about lives in one config block, shown here for reference.

settings of bafof-yagef:
JOROX_PIN=8740
JOROX_TENANT=pelox
JOROX_METRICS_HOST=metrics.jorox.qorvelworks.internal
JOROX_SEAL=seal_c78f63c1
JOROX_STANDBY_TEAM=norax

Handover note — Crumbwheel order cutoffs.

Welcome aboard. The bakery cutoff rule in Crumbwheel closes same-day orders at 14:00 local to each storefront, not UTC — this has bitten us twice. Holiday overrides live in the calendar service and take precedence silently, so always check there first when a cutoff looks wrong. To unlock the calendar service's admin console after a restart, enter the recovery passphrase below.

vault phrase of bagap-bahaf = silion-pelox-sorox-casdor-quenwyn-fraax-eliox-praael-kelion-quenvan-kasox-rusael-norius-belvan

## Changelog — DiffScope 4.2.1 (key rotation)

This release rotates the signing key for DiffScope, our large-file diff viewer, following the scheduled annual rotation. No functional changes are included. Verification of 4.2.0 and earlier continues to work via the archived key in the trust bundle. All artifacts from 4.2.1 onward, including the streaming-chunk renderer, are signed with the new key below.

release key, fahop-bahip: bky19_PspfQHRyvVcYD9LdZgo